Tinubu Establishes Ministry of Livestock Development to Address Herders-Farmers Clashes

President Bola Tinubu has announced the formation of the Ministry of Livestock Development.
The announcement was made on Tuesday, July 9, at the State House during the inauguration of the Renewed Hope Livestock Reform Implementation Committee.
This initiative aims to resolve the frequent conflicts between herders and farmers in Nigeria. The committee was established following a report from the National Conference on Livestock Reforms and Mitigation of Associated Conflicts in Nigeria.
Key figures at the inauguration included Vice President Kashim Shettima, Secretary to the Government of the Federation George Akume, and Chief of Staff to the President Femi Gbajabiamila, among other cabinet members.
On September 15, 2023, President Tinubu had approved the establishment of a presidential committee to reform the livestock industry and provide long-term solutions to the recurring clashes between herders and farmers. As of now, a minister for the newly created ministry has not been appointed.
